How they compare

Paraguay currently reports 275 years against 262 years in South Africa, a difference of 13 years.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 561 shared years of data; in 1462 it was South Africa ahead.

Paraguay ranks 34th and South Africa ranks 37th of 159 countries.

Number of years the country has been colonized from overseas by the European colonial power(s) in a specific year, between Belgium, United Kingdom, France, Germany, Netherlands, Portugal, Spain, and Italy, or a combination of them.
